# Pin to Toolbar

> Pin SaveMate to your browser toolbar for instant access to stream detection.

Pinning SaveMate to your toolbar keeps the extension icon always visible, so you can immediately see when a video stream is detected on the current page.

## How to pin SaveMate

  <Step title="Open the extensions menu">
    Click the **puzzle piece icon** in the top-right corner of your browser toolbar. This opens the extensions menu showing all installed extensions.

  <Step title="Find SaveMate">
    Locate **SaveMate** in the list of extensions.

  <Step title="Click the pin icon">
    Click the **pin icon** next to SaveMate. It will turn blue, indicating that the extension is now pinned to your toolbar.

## Why pin the extension?

When pinned, the SaveMate icon provides visual feedback:

* **Inactive** — The icon appears in its default state when no streams are detected on the current page
* **Active** — The icon lights up with a blue indicator when one or more video streams are detected

Without pinning, you'd need to open the extensions menu each time to check for detected streams.

## Browser-specific notes

  <Accordion title="Google Chrome">
    The puzzle piece icon is in the top-right of the toolbar, to the left of your profile picture. If you don't see it, click the three-dot menu and check **Extensions**.

  <Accordion title="Microsoft Edge">
    Edge uses the same puzzle piece icon. You can also right-click the SaveMate icon in the extensions menu and select **Show in toolbar**.

  <Accordion title="Brave">
    Brave works identically to Chrome. The puzzle piece icon is in the same location.
